As the world becomes increasingly interconnected, many expats are looking to relocate to Europe for work-related purposes
The first step for those looking to move abroad is usually obtaining a visa overseas and thankfully there are a variety of types of visas available to expats in Europe
The first type of visa is the Work Visa This type of visa is usually issued to foreign workers who have already secured a job The employer must sponsor the visa application by obtaining a labor market test and highlighting the foreign worker's skills this enables the worker to live and work in that specific country
Another type of visa is the Language Study Visa for Foreigners This visa is intended for students who wish to study study in a European country usually a limited-duration visa
